Leyh Signs With Greensboro in ECHL; Receives NHL and AHL Camp Invites

WALTHAM, Mass. - The captain of the 2024-25 Bentley Falcons, Ethan Leyh has signed with the Greensboro Gargoyles, the ECHL affiliate of the Carolina Hurricanes. Leyh also received invites to Carolina's NHL Rookie Camp and the preseason camp of their AHL affiliate, the Chicago Wolves. 

A two-year captain at Bentley, Leyh capped his NCAA career by helping lead the Falcons to their first Atlantic Hockey Championship and NCAA tournament appearance this past March.

In 72 games at Bentley over two seasons, the Anmore, British Columbia native notched 30 goals and 41 assists.

He was twice voted to the All-Atlantic Hockey team, with a first team selection in 2025. He was named the 2025 AHA co-Best Defensive Forward and was a finalist for the Forward of the Year award.

Leyh was also voted Bentley's Team MVP for the 2023-24 and 2024-25 seasons.

Ethan earned his master's degree from Bentley in business administration in May. He is the fifth player from the 2024-25 squad to sign with a pro team this summer, joining Sam Duerr, Nick Bochen, Tanner Main and Artem Buzoverya.
